Yield-focused segments in detail

Boutique hotels: 6–10% gross annually on well-run properties, capital appreciation 4–8% p.a. in top markets. Short-let residential portfolios: 6–9% gross yield in coastal/urban markets (Chania, Rethymnon Old Town, Athens Riviera, Kolonaki). Commercial retail: 4–7% gross on prime Athens/Thessaloniki high-street; 5–8% on suburban and secondary locations. Ultra-luxury villas: 4–6% gross (yield-lite, appreciation-driven — 6–10% p.a. capital gain typical in Elounda, Vouliagmeni, Mykonos).

Golden Visa combined with investment

Most non-EU investment buyers structure their €400K (Crete, Peloponnese, most of Greece) or €800K (Attica, Thessaloniki, Mykonos, Santorini) purchase to generate rental yield alongside residency. Popular structures: (1) single-asset high-yield boutique hotel/apartments; (2) diversified portfolio (villa + retail unit); (3) build-to-let (buy plot + construction package). Institutional vs private capital dynamics

Institutional focus (2020–2026): Athens hotel portfolios, Hellinikon-adjacent residential, Riviera new-build. Private focus: Cycladic villas (Santorini/Mykonos/Paros), Crete luxury coastal. Family-office focus: Elounda and Porto Heli ultra-prime seafront. Cross-border capital: growing UK, US and Israeli buyer share; historically strong Middle-Eastern and Russian participation (Cyprus/Limassol axis).

Yield-focused strategies by asset class

Greek investment strategies by yield profile: Athens short-let apartments — 6–10% gross yields, Kolonaki/Neos Kosmos/Koukaki, €150K–€400K entry, high management demands. Cretan Old Town townhouses — 8–12% gross yields in Chania, Rethymnon Old Towns, €150K–€400K, seasonal short-let plus winter long-let. Cycladic villa short-let — 5–8% net yields with strong appreciation, €500K–€2M+ entry. Athens student-let apartments — 4–6% net yields, Zografou/Ilisia (near universities), €120K–€250K, stable low-management.

Development & value-add plays

Higher-return strategies for capital-intensive investors: Renovation-plus-flip — 1960s–70s apartments in Kolonaki, Kifisia, Chania Old Town (typical margin 15–25% net after 6–12 month execution). Off-plan luxury development — 40–60 new villa projects annually in Crete, Peloponnese, Cyclades (15–25% margin at completion vs comparable finished stock). Hotel conversion — boutique projects in Old Towns (Chania, Rethymnon, Nafplio) — 25–40% margin over 18–30 months execution. Land banking — pre-permit land in appreciating corridors with 5–10 year hold horizons.

What is a typical Greek investment property holding period?

Institutional: 5–8 years. Private lifestyle-plus-yield: 10–15+ years. Golden Visa buyers: often held through initial 5-year renewal cycle minimum, then evaluated. Very low forced-selling in the mature Greek property market — thin secondary liquidity means holders tend to be patient.

How is Greek rental income taxed?

Short-let (Airbnb): 15% flat on first €12,000, then 35% up to €35K, then 45% above. Long-let: same brackets. Property companies (SICAV or similar): different corporate tax treatment. Ktimatoemporiki\'s tax coordination team introduces vetted CPAs.

Can I mortgage a Greek investment property as a foreign buyer?

Yes, but limited to 40–60% LTV for non-EU buyers, rates typically Euribor + 3–4.5%. Cash purchase remains the norm for luxury tier. Ktimatoemporiki\'s banking partners handle mortgage introductions.

What are Greece's foreign-investor tax rates on rental income?

Rental income taxed at 15% (up to €12K annual), 35% (€12K–€35K), 45% (above €35K) — same rates for residents and non-residents. Short-let AirBnB income taxed as rental income (not commercial). Can non-EU citizens buy investment property freely in Greece?

Yes with minor exceptions. EU citizens buy freely nationwide. Non-EU citizens are unrestricted in most of Greece but require special approval for "border-zone" properties (parts of northern Greece, some islands adjacent to Turkey). All Cretan, Cycladic (except Kastellorizo), Peloponnese and mainland Athens properties are unrestricted for all nationalities.
